GraphQL to ReasonML

The purpose of this project is to transform a graphql schema into a reason file with type interfaces that when implemented constitute a graphql server.

Returning non primitive types

Built in types are automatically converted into reason types for example Float becomes float.

More complex types can be returned and enforced but some additional details need to be annotated via a special decorator.

type Cake @bsType(type: "CakeModule.t") {
  name: String!
}

type Query {
  cake: Cake!
}

Compiling the above will result in something like the following.

type cake('ctx) = {. "name": (CakeModule.t, __nameArgs, 'ctx) => string}
/* Arguments for name */
and __nameArgs = {.}
and query('root, 'ctx) = {
  .
  "cake": ('root, __cakeArgs, 'ctx) => CakeModule.t,
}
/* Arguments for cake */
and __cakeArgs = {.};

Limitations

  • GraphQL types must start with uppercase letter.
